WebApr 14, 2024 · When it comes to making ethical decisions, both movements posit that no one person’s pleasure or pain counts more than anyone else’s. In addition, both utilitarianism and effective altruism are agnostic about how to achieve their goals: what matters is achieving the greatest value, not necessarily how we get there.

Helping others feels good. There is some evidence to suggest that when you help others, it can promote physiological changes in the brain linked with happiness. 1. Helping others can also improve our support networks and encourage us to be more active. 4 This, in turn, can improve our self-esteem. 3. 2. the monastery of the angelsWebAltruism.
